0

値(例:4567643)を(4,567,643)に単純にフォーマットするスクリプトが必要です。通貨記号や小数は必要ありません。私はこれを含むいくつかのスクリプトを見つけました:

http://weblogs.asp.net/scottgu/archive/2010/06/10/jquery-globalization-plugin-from-microsoft.aspx

しかし、それは私が必要とするものにとって非常に重いです、私は非常に軽い何かが私が必要とすることをすることができると想像します(そしてうまくいけば別のプラグインを必要としません)。

どんな助けでも大歓迎です。

4

1 に答える 1

0

これが私がそれが役に立つと思うかもしれない他の誰かのために私が最終的に作ったコードです:

$.fn.digits = function(){ 
    return this.each(function(){ 
        $(this).text( $(this).text().replace(/(\d)(?=(\d\d\d)+(?!\d))/g, "$1,") ); 
    })
}

$(".currency").digits();

クラス'currency'のdivに、フォーマットする数値が含まれている場合。

于 2012-06-26T12:35:33.520 に答える